Transaction f314c0a6568efb5ba5f6f101fc35a6c5e59c955a932e273c6e2a89d96e1ec6ba
1 Input
2 Outputs
- f314c0a6568efb5ba5f6f101fc35a6c5e59c955a932e273c6e2a89d96e1ec6ba:0
- f314c0a6568efb5ba5f6f101fc35a6c5e59c955a932e273c6e2a89d96e1ec6ba:1
value 18593667
address 1Ermi8wf8Pfyo8n45oBY4XYPGw7YFYjCA3
value 861620950
address 1AEd1zYWkeHDt8RpEXHUJojzkwxR9EF2bD